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is OKs 7 More Laws. Here’s What Each One Does

The measures bar DEI offices and local net-zero plans, and residents can sue governments that violate the new rules, officials said.

  • On Wednesday,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is signed legislation banning local governments from funding diversity, equity and inclusion programs and net-zero clean energy initiatives, effective Jan. 1, 2027.
  • DeSantis justified the measures by describing DEI as "an ideological construct" that discriminates against white males, adding that Florida is "where woke goes to die" in his push against such initiatives.
  • Local officials violating the law face potential suspension while residents can sue for non-compliance; Rep. Berny Jacques, R-Seminole, called the net-zero provision the "green new scam."
  • Tallahassee City Commissioner Dianne Williams-Cox warned the bill could impact minority-owned businesses, stating 150 vendors risk losing $35 million in contracts gained over three years.
  • Democratic lawmakers and NAACP Gainesville branch president Evelyn Foxx opposed the measure citing First Amendment concerns, though the law preserves Black History Month and other legally designated holidays.
